Run 5, with higher surface runoff than uplift rate (r/u = 6.0)

This is the fifth experimental run in this rainfall-runoff-uplift-erosion apparatus, constructed to test stream network stability over long periods of erosion. Surface runoff was the dominant erosion mechanism. This run was conducted in 2000 by Les Hasbargen for his PhD thesis at St. Anthony Falls Laboratory at University of Minnesota.
